ScienceShipwrecks of Shackleton and Scott recreated in 3D after deep-sea expedition

Canadian scientists have visited the remains of vessels linked to polar exploration and recreated them in digital 3D form. In the darkness and silt of the seafloor, the bow of a ship emerged more than 1,000ft below the Labrador Sea. It was the final vessel used by famed polar explorer Ernest Shackleton. The expedition comes amid what researchers describe as a “golden era” for investigating shipwrecks.
